Given the short history of the Button min-raise, your 11-bb's, a decent little A2s...a pretty good spot for a resteal PF.

You got a great flop, a weak'ish lead, plenty of FE...closer to 'standard' than 'plain bad' (though I'd prefer to open-push this particular flop having just called PF).

I believe your play was fine. It is hard to get a good read on any player at a SNG, but there are plenty of players who will try to push you around. I have to believe that even if he had a K you had plenty of outs to make this play (any diamond and probably any A) - with 12 outs - two cards to come - and a chance that he may fold at the raise I can definetly see the logic in making this push.

I can't say if I would do it every time, but if I feel like someone is trying to push me around, I will find some hand to make a stand, and this one seems like a good opprotunity for that.
